The overview below groups typical Gas Furnace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Most routine gas furnace repairs, such as fixing a pilot light or replacing a thermocouple, typically fall within the $250-$600 range. Many local contractors handle these common issues efficiently within this band. Fewer projects reach the higher end for more extensive repairs.
Moderate Repairs - Mid-level repairs, like replacing a blower motor or fixing a faulty circuit board, usually cost between $600 and $1,500. These projects are common and often involve parts and labor in this middle range. Larger repairs are less frequent but can push costs higher.
Full Furnace Replacement - Replacing an entire gas furnace generally ranges from $2,500 to $5,000, depending on the model and installation complexity. Many local service providers complete standard replacements within this range, while more advanced setups can be more costly.
Complex or Emergency Projects - Larger, more complex projects such as extensive system upgrades or emergency repairs can exceed $5,000. These are less common but represent the upper end of typical costs handled by local pros for high-end or complicated installations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s that a gas furnace needs repair? Signs include inconsistent heating, unusual noises, increased energy bills, or the furnace not turning on at all. If these issues occur, it's advisable to have a professional inspection.
What types of repairs do gas furnace service providers typically handle? Local contractors can address issues such as pilot light problems, thermostat malfunctions, blower motor failures, and heat exchanger repairs.

What maintenance tasks can help prevent gas furnace breakdowns? Regular filter replacements, keeping vents clear, and scheduling routine inspections can help maintain furnace performance and reduce the risk of unexpected repairs.
